Resultant force via vector addition
Steps:
- Determine force directions from the diagram (e.g., 6N horizontal, 8N at angle).
- Apply parallelogram law: construct parallelogram with vectors as adjacent sides.
- Resultant R is the diagonal vector from tail to opposite head.
- Calculate magnitude √(6² + 8²) = 10N if perpendicular; compare direction to options.
